infra-Legalities Research Team contribute to key Global Watchlisting policy making forum

GCTF Watchlisting Guidance Manual Initiative: Virtual Consultations on the Application of Watchlists of Known and Suspected Terrorists, Including Foreign Terrorist Fighters - Webinar on International Cooperation, Redress and Oversight Mechanisms, and Quality Control to take place on 8 February 2021.

On 8 February 2021, the infra-Legalities research team participated in the third technical workshop of the Global Counterterrorism Forum’s Watchlisting Guidance Manual initiative – which is setting global standards on how terrorist watchlists and databases should be created and interconnected around the globe. The political and legal stakes of this ‘technical’ initiative are significant, to say the least.
